Raisin and Cinnamon Swirl Bread
Ingredients
- bread flour500 g
- raisins100 g
- brown sugar50 g
- active dry yeast7 g
- warm water250 ml
- unsalted butter50 g
- egg1 large
- cinnamon10 g
- salt5 g
Instructions
- 1
In a large bowl, combine the bread flour, brown sugar, cinnamon, and salt.
- 2
In a separate small bowl, dissolve the active dry yeast in the warm water and let it sit for about 5 minutes until it becomes frothy.
- 3
Melt the unsalted butter and let it cool slightly.
- 4
Add the yeast mixture, melted butter, and egg to the dry ingredients. Mix until a dough forms.
- 5
Knead the dough on a floured surface for about 10 minutes until it is smooth and elastic.
- 6
Place the dough in a lightly greased bowl, cover it with a damp cloth, and let it rise in a warm place for about 1 to
- 7
5 hours, or until it has doubled in size.
- 8
Once the dough has risen, punch it down and roll it out into a rectangle.
- 9
Sprinkle the raisins evenly over the dough.
- 10
Roll the dough up tightly from one of the short ends to form a loaf.
- 11
Place the loaf in a greased loaf pan, cover it, and let it rise again for about 30 to 45 minutes.
- 12
Preheat your oven to 180°C (350°F).
- 13
Bake the bread for 30 to 35 minutes, or until it is golden brown and sounds hollow when tapped on the bottom.
- 14
Remove the bread from the oven and let it cool on a wire rack before slicing and serving.
